HC Deb 30 October 2000 vol 355 c304W
Mr. Menzies Campbell

To ask the Secretary of State for the Environment, Transport and the Regions (1) if he will make a statement on his Department's contribution to(a) the High Frequency Active Auroral Research Programme and (b) the European Incoherent Scatter Radar Project, stating in each case the (i) nature, (ii) duration and (iii) purpose of the contribution, including how many staff were attached to the projects and what financial support was given; [134232]

(2) if he will list the ionospheric research projects in which his Department is involved, stating in each case (a) the number of personnel involved, (b) the duration of the project and (c) the yearly and total project cost to his Department; and if he will make a statement; [134233]

(3) what assessment his Department has made as to the environmental effects of ionospheric research; and if he will make a statement; [134234]

(4) if he will make a statement on his Department's contribution to the Scientific and Technological Options Assessment Panel's investigation into the local, global and public health risks of ionospheric research. [134236]

Mr. Mullin

The Department has had no involvement in ionospheric research and has not carried out or contributed to any assessments or investigations of possible environmental and public health effects. My understanding is that the Scientific and Technological Assessment Panel do not currently have a study on this topic.
